有没有一种方法可以通过使用命令到终端,递归到文件夹来检查PHP文件是否损坏?非常感谢。
在我的例子中,对于损坏,我指的是可能导致PHP解释问题的糟糕编码。
损坏是什么意思?我想你的意思是语法错误吧?
您可以使用检查终端中的语法错误
php -l file.php
您可以使用find
递归搜索并检查所有php文件:
find . -type f -name '*.php' -exec php -l {} ;
希望这有帮助:)
问题是由我的文件中的字节顺序标记引起的。用这个答案来修复一切用BOM搜索UTF-8文件的优雅方式?